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Principles of Metal Finishing - More often than not, metal polishing is essential for appearance or clean-room situations. It really is among the most recognized practices simply because of its use in improving the original attractiveness of the item, such as, motorcycle parts, vehicle parts or cookware. What's more, a large number of clean-rooms need a sleek finish as a way to limit the penetrability of the material that will result in dirt to gather and contaminate. A really good demonstration of this usage could be in vacuum chambers. You will discover a number of approaches to finish metal, and below we'll discuss a little concerning the various processes required. Metal may be finished manually by hand, with spec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A polishing compound or paste is commonly applied, that could include dolomite, chromium oxide, chalk, limestone, aluminum o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, because of its substandard th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its somewhat high viscosity is amongst the time intensive. Then again, items crafted from non-ferrous metals are often more responsive to polishing, as these need the lowest number of operations.
When a high processing quality is not really required, higher pad speeds should be considered. A lower pad speed is commonly employed should a high quality mirror finish is expected. Finishing buffs smothered in compound are appreciably impacted by the pressures on the pad. The strength of the surface pressure may be increased to a specified extent, although overreaching the maximum level of load not merely cuts down the quality level of the procedure, but in addition degrades efficiency, causes wear to the component, and also a tangible heating up of the work-pieces, brought about by friction. When you are working on thin metal, it will be higher temperature (and the subsequent pliability of the material) that causes items to distort, bend or twist. Generally, it needs a specialized polisher to take into consideration every one of these things to equally avert harm to the metal part and to deliver the results proficiently. In order to radically improve the quality of the completed finish, the finishing action is required to be executed with less aggression and not as much pressure in order to ultimately deliver a surface area that doesn't have any scores or marks caused by the finishing procedure, thereby 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
